LFB Fireboat attending a fire at Colonial Wharf
A fireboat tackles a fire at Colonial Wharf. A typical big Thameside fire of the sort which the London fire Brigade had tackled over 100 years: Colonial Wharf, Wapping High Street, E1, 27th September 1935. This nine-storey warehouse was full of crude rubber and burned for four days, during which time a number of explosions took place. Sixty pumps twenty special appliances and three fireboats, manned in all by 600 firefighters, fought the huge blaze: they successfully prevented fire spread to the surrounding warehouses. Date: 1935

In this evocative photograph, a London Fire Brigade fireboat valiantly battles a raging inferno at Colonial Wharf along the Thames in Wapping, East London, on the 27th of September 1935. The nine-story warehouse, filled with crude rubber, had been engulfed in flames for days, and the situation was further complicated by a series of explosions that occurred throughout the ordeal. The London Fire Brigade had faced such challenges numerous times over the past century, and they were well-prepared for this formidable task. With over 600 firefighters, 60 pumps, and 20 special appliances, they mobilized three fireboats to tackle the blaze. The fireboats, equipped with powerful jets and capable of dousing the flames from the water, proved to be an essential asset in preventing the fire from spreading to the surrounding warehouses and causing even more damage. The scene is a testament to the bravery and determination of the firefighters, who worked tirelessly to contain the fire and protect the surrounding area. The iconic London landmarks, such as the Tower Bridge and the cranes and barges at the docks, can be seen in the background, adding to the historical context of this significant event. The fire at Colonial Wharf burned for four days, but the London Fire Brigade's efforts ultimately proved successful in saving the nearby structures and minimizing the impact on the community.
